Voice Recording Options
To switch speakerphone mode:
1.
From the voice recorder menu (see page 116), select Play or
Play:Speaker and press
.
2.
Select Voice Data and press
.
3.
Select your desired voice recording and press Options (right
softkey).
4.
Select Speaker On or Speaker Off and press
.
Tip:
You can also switch the speakerphone mode by pressing
(left
softkey) during step 4 above.
To edit the title:
1.
From the voice recorder menu (see page 116), select Play or
Play:Speaker and press
.
2.
Select Voice Data and press
.
3.
Select your desired voice recording and press Options (right
softkey).
4.
Select Edit Title and press
.
5.
Edit the title (up to 16 characters) and press OK (left softkey).
To set the audio quality:
1.
Display the voice recorder menu (see page 116).
2.
Select Record and press Settings (right softkey).
3.
Select Audio Quality or Mic Sensitivity and press
.
Ⅲ
Audio Quality to change the recording quality.
Ⅲ
Mic Sensitivity to change the microphone sensitivity.
4.
Select High or Low and press
.
Note:
When Audio Quality setting is High, the total recording time will be
reduced.
